Rusolovo,a Seligdar unit,plans to build Amur Metallurgical Plant in Khabarovsk Region . Operations expected to kick off by 2028. Igor Korytov,Director of Tin Ore Company, announced it at a briefing in Komsomolsk-on-Amur.

Korytov outlined big production goals. He said plant aims for annual output of at least 8,300 metric tons of refined tin by 2029. This ambitious move demands hefty investment. At least 17.6 billion rubles (around $226.12 million) will be poured in starting 2026 .

Building Amur Plant should create about 422 jobs,boosting local employment . Rusolovo,a top player in Russia's tin industry,wants to ramp up its capacity with this new facility. Will it all go as planned? Time will tell…
